How Does the Suzhou Ruitai NCU Communication Box Operate?
1. Massive Data Collection and Translation (Connection Layer)
Physical Connection: Acting as a data hub for the entire power station, the NCU connects hundreds of field devices, including tracking control units (TCUs), inverters, and weather monitoring stations.
It supports multiple communication interfaces like RS485, ZigBee, and Bluetooth to establish physical links with all equipment.
Protocol Conversion: Devices made by different manufacturers (such as inverters) use different communication protocols, which creates compatibility barriers. Equipped with powerful built-in protocol conversion modules, the NCU supports mainstream protocols including Modbus, TCP/IP, and MQTT.
It converts all kinds of heterogeneous industrial signals into unified standard data formats, allowing smooth data exchange between every connected device.
2. Edge Intelligence for Real-Time Control (Computation and Control Layer)
AI Intelligent Decision-Making: This is the core strength of the NCU. It is not just a signal transmitter, but a "brain" with computing power.
It integrates advanced tracking algorithms and combines data from built-in sensors such as wind speed and snow load to calculate the optimal angle of the solar panels in real time.
Millisecond-Level Response: With edge computing capabilities, the NCU processes complex calculations locally and issues control commands within milliseconds.
It instantly sends control commands to the TCU to adjust panel angles for maximum energy output, eliminating delays caused by cloud-based processing.
3. A Stable and Reliable Information Backbone (Communication Layer)
Interference-Resistant Transmission: In complex outdoor electromagnetic environments, the Intelligent PV Communication Box features advanced lightning protection and anti-interference capabilities, ensuring that critical data is transmitted to the cloud or central monitoring system quickly, securely, and reliably.
Seamless Data Continuity: In the event of network instability, the NCU's edge computing capability enables local data buffering.
Once the connection is restored, data is automatically synchronized, ensuring complete integrity with no loss.
4. All-Weather System Protection (Protection Layer)
Precision Calibration: The system features dual GPS calibration to continuously correct positioning in real time, ensuring highly accurate solar tracking and optimal performance under all conditions.
Reliable Backup Protection: In the event of a sudden power outage, the built-in UPS seamlessly takes over, maintaining communication and control systems online while ensuring essential operations and critical data.

How to Install the Intelligent PV Communication Box?
1. Selecting the Installation Location
Recommended locations: Inside a control cabinet near the PV array, inside a communication box, in a dedicated equipment cabinet, or in a well-sheltered and protected outdoor area.
Installation location requirements:
① Avoid areas with strong interference; keep away from high-power motors, high-frequency equipment, and high-voltage power lines.
② The installation location must ensure accessibility for personnel, ease of wiring, visibility of status indicators, and convenience for future maintenance.
③ Must meet environmental protection requirements.
2. Mounting the Device
Depending on the project structure, the NCU can be installed in a control cabinet, wall-mounted, or installed within an equipment enclosure.
Installation steps:
Step 1: Confirm the installation location.
Step 2: Secure the device using bolts, mounting brackets, and/or mounting rails.
Step 3: Check the installation status to ensure the device is level and stable, has sufficient wiring space, and enjoys good heat dissipation conditions.
3. Power Connection
During installation, verify the input voltage range, power polarity, and grounding requirements.
Connections include power input, protective grounding, and lightning protection.
Take care to avoid reverse polarity, voltage fluctuations, and operation without grounding. 4. Communication Connection between NCU and TCU
A key step in NCU installation is establishing communication with the TCU.
Typical connection: Tracking System → TCU → Communication Cable → NCU
Ensure correct communication line connections, proper device address configuration, and consistent communication parameters.
5. Connection between NCU and SCADA System
After connecting the field equipment, the NCU must be integrated into the monitoring system.
Connect and commission the network configuration, IP address settings, and data point mapping, then perform communication tests.
FAQ
Q: Will network or power outages affect data transmission and system control?
A: The system is designed to handle such scenarios. The device is equipped with a built-in UPS backup battery that ensures continuous operation even during unexpected power interruptions. In addition, its edge computing capability enables local data caching and intelligent synchronization.
This ensures stable command execution and data reporting even during intermittent network disruptions. Once connectivity is restored, all data is automatically synchronized to the cloud, ensuring complete data integrity.
Q: Does this intelligent PV communication box support remote monitoring and fault diagnostics?
A: Yes, it fully supports real-time monitoring and remote control. When integrated with Ruitai's SCADA or IoT platform, operators can easily monitor the entire plant's performance without being on-site.
The system also enables remote diagnostics, allowing issues to be quickly identified and resolved, significantly reducing communication failures and lowering overall O&M costs.
Q: How does it ensure solar panels are always positioned at the optimal angle for maximum energy output?
A: The NCU is equipped with advanced AI-driven tracking algorithms and integrated environmental sensors, including wind and snow detection.
It continuously analyzes real-time conditions to intelligently adjust panel angles for optimal energy generation. In addition, dual GPS calibration ensures precise tracking accuracy, effectively improving the overall energy generation efficiency of the solar system.
Q: Is installation and configuration complicated? Does it support mobile setup?
A: The setup process is designed to be simple and efficient. In addition to standard PC-based configuration, the device also supports Bluetooth setup via mobile devices.
During on-site installation and commissioning, parameters can be quickly configured through a smartphone using low-power Bluetooth connectivity, significantly improving convenience and overall efficiency.
